Operation
To set an Absence Message
1. Lift the handset or press the ON/OFF key.
2. Enter the Absence Message code (default = 729).
3. Enter the Absence Message number. (See Table 5-1 above.)
4. If desired, enter the 4-digit returning time.
5. Press HOLD key.
6. Replace the handset or press the ON/OFF key.
To cancel an Absence Message
1. Lift the handset or press the ON/OFF key.
2. Enter the Absence Message code (default = 729).
3. Press HOLD key.
4. Replace the handset or press the ON/OFF key.
